
1990 MLD 1488
MANZOOR AHMAD
Versus
THE STATE
Per Sh. Muhammad Zubair, J.
(a) Constitution of Pakistan, 1973 Article 14
After hearing the learned counsel for the parties and perusing the record, I find that there is substance in the submission of the learned counsel for the petitioner that in view of Article14 of the Constitution Eaves-dropping, tapping stealthily, photographing something inside the house are invasions on privacy and as such is not permissible under the Constitution as well as in Islam. Furthermore, the police has entered the premises without observing the formalities of law, hence the evidence so far collected is open to objection. [p. 1490]A
